Appended the updated version of this patch. --- Use PHYSDEVOP_get_free_pirq to implement find_unbound_pirq Use the new hypercall PHYSDEVOP_get_free_pirq to ask Xen to allocate a pirq. Remove the unsupported PHYSDEVOP_get_nr_pirqs hypercall to get the amount of pirq available. Signed-off-by: Stefano Stabellini <stefano.stabellini@xxxxxxxxxxxxx> diff --git a/drivers/xen/events.c b/drivers/xen/events.c index 2811bb9..9f19daa 100644 --- a/drivers/xen/events.c +++ b/drivers/xen/events.c @@ -105,7 +105,6 @@ struct irq_info static struct irq_info *irq_info; static int *pirq_to_irq; -static int nr_pirqs; static int *evtchn_to_irq; struct cpu_evtchn_s { @@ -385,12 +384,17 @@ static int get_nr_hw_irqs(void) return ret; } -/* callers of this function should make sure that PHYSDEVOP_get_nr_pirqs - * succeeded otherwise nr_pirqs won't hold the right value */ -static int find_unbound_pirq(void) +static int find_unbound_pirq(int type) { - int i; - for (i = nr_pirqs-1; i >= 0; i--) { + int rc, i; + struct physdev_get_free_pirq op_get_free_pirq; + op_get_free_pirq.type = type; + + rc = HYPERVISOR_physdev_op(PHYSDEVOP_get_free_pirq, &op_get_free_pirq); + if (!rc) + return op_get_free_pirq.pirq; + + for (i = NR_IRQS_LEGACY; i <= nr_irqs-1; i++) { if (pirq_to_irq[i] < 0) return i; } @@ -611,9 +615,9 @@ int xen_map_pirq_gsi(unsigned pirq, unsigned gsi, int shareable, char *name) spin_lock(&irq_mapping_update_lock); - if ((pirq > nr_pirqs) || (gsi > nr_irqs)) { + if ((pirq > nr_irqs) || (gsi > nr_irqs)) { printk(KERN_WARNING "xen_map_pirq_gsi: %s %s is incorrect!\n", - pirq > nr_pirqs ? "nr_pirqs" :"", + pirq > nr_irqs ? "nr_pirqs" :"", gsi > nr_irqs ? "nr_irqs" : ""); goto out; } @@ -672,7 +676,7 @@ void xen_allocate_pirq_msi(char *name, int *irq, int *pirq) if (*irq == -1) goto out; - *pirq = find_unbound_pirq(); + *pirq = find_unbound_pirq(MAP_PIRQ_TYPE_MSI); if (*pirq == -1) goto out; @@ -1506,26 +1510,17 @@ void xen_callback_vector(void) {} void __init xen_init_IRQ(void) { - int i, rc; - struct physdev_nr_pirqs op_nr_pirqs; + int i; cpu_evtchn_mask_p = kcalloc(nr_cpu_ids, sizeof(struct cpu_evtchn_s), GFP_KERNEL); irq_info = kcalloc(nr_irqs, sizeof(*irq_info), GFP_KERNEL); - rc = HYPERVISOR_physdev_op(PHYSDEVOP_get_nr_pirqs, &op_nr_pirqs); - if (rc < 0) { - nr_pirqs = nr_irqs; - if (rc != -ENOSYS) - printk(KERN_WARNING "PHYSDEVOP_get_nr_pirqs returned rc=%d\n", rc); - } else { - if (xen_pv_domain() && !xen_initial_domain()) - nr_pirqs = max((int)op_nr_pirqs.nr_pirqs, nr_irqs); - else - nr_pirqs = op_nr_pirqs.nr_pirqs; - } - pirq_to_irq = kcalloc(nr_pirqs, sizeof(*pirq_to_irq), GFP_KERNEL); - for (i = 0; i < nr_pirqs; i++) + /* We are using nr_irqs as the maximum number of pirq available but + * that number is actually chosen by Xen and we don't know exactly + * what it is. Be careful choosing high pirq numbers. */ + pirq_to_irq = kcalloc(nr_irqs, sizeof(*pirq_to_irq), GFP_KERNEL); + for (i = 0; i < nr_irqs; i++) pirq_to_irq[i] = -1; evtchn_to_irq = kcalloc(NR_EVENT_CHANNELS, sizeof(*evtchn_to_irq), diff --git a/include/xen/interface/physdev.h b/include/xen/interface/physdev.h index 2b2c66c..534cac8 100644 --- a/include/xen/interface/physdev.h +++ b/include/xen/interface/physdev.h @@ -188,6 +188,16 @@ struct physdev_nr_pirqs { uint32_t nr_pirqs; }; +/* type is MAP_PIRQ_TYPE_GSI or MAP_PIRQ_TYPE_MSI + * the hypercall returns a free pirq */ +#define PHYSDEVOP_get_free_pirq 23 +struct physdev_get_free_pirq { + /* IN */ + int type; + /* OUT */ + uint32_t pirq; +}; + /* * Notify that some PIRQ-bound event channels have been unmasked. * ** This command is obsolete since interface version 0x00030202 and is ** _______________________________________________ Xen-devel mailing list Xen-devel@xxxxxxxxxxxxxxxxxxx http://lists.xensource.com/xen-devel
